Good morning, Amarillo. Here's your local news at a glance for Saturday, the 6th of December.

COMMUNITY NEWS

  • Amarillo Zoo will host a Winter Break Camp for kids ages 5 to 12 on Saturday, Dec. 13 from 10:00 a.m. to 2:00 p.m. The event costs $25 and offers crafts, animal encounters + holiday cheer while parents shop.  96.9 KISS FM
  • Amarillo Animal Management and Welfare is waiving cat adoption fees through Dec. 13 at 3501 S. Osage (10 am to 6 pm, Tuesday-Saturday). Residents can adopt spayed, vaccinated, and microchipped cats for a loving home.  96.9 KISS FM
  • Cowboy Christmas is a free, family-friendly holiday event held today from 11 a.m. to 2 p.m. at 809 E. Ninth St. in Panhandle—featuring Cowboy Santa, longhorn chili and mini photo sessions to support the Harrington Cancer Foundation.  NewsChannel 10
  • Amarillo’s Code Blue Warming Station reached its 20-person indoor capacity as freezing temperatures push more residents and their pets to seek shelter. The volunteer-run station works with local nonprofits & redirects people to alternative safe options when full.  Amarillo Globe-News
  • Amarillo’s Downtown Public Library will host the Memory Cafe for residents with memory loss and their caregivers on Dec. 13 from 12 to 2 p.m. The program, started last year, offers free music, games, and activities to help participants stay socially connected + engaged.  NewsChannel 10
  • Help 4 The Holidays is urging Amarillo residents to donate essential items (toiletries, toys, winter gear, and more) at Wolflin Square at the old Vexus building, 2221 I-40 Frontage Rd. The drive stays open today through Sunday as donations slow and families need support.  NewsTalk 940 AM
  • Olivia’s Angels hosted its annual tree lighting on Tuesday, Dec. 2 at the Harrington Cancer and Health Foundation in Amarillo, honoring caregivers and hospice patients while celebrating Sister Olivia’s lasting legacy. Community donations helped brighten lives and promise the tradition continues for generations.  Amarillo Globe-News
  • The City of Amarillo’s Community Development Department and the Amarillo Continuum of Care are calling for residents to volunteer for the 2026 Point-in-Time Count on Jan. 23 to survey homelessness and guide future federal funding. Volunteers may also donate gift bag items at the Simms Building (808 S. Buchanan St).  ABC 7 Amarillo

CULTURE NEWS

  • The Amarillo Wind Ensemble will perform its free Hometown Christmas concert at 7 p.m. Sunday, Dec. 7, at First Christian Church, 3001 Wolflin Ave, where Santa Claus will appear. Donations will benefit Teen Christmas + the Pantex Christmas Project.  NewsChannel 10
  • Last Friday, downtown Amarillo was lit up as Center City Amarillo hosted its annual Electric Light Parade — showcasing a West Texas Christmas theme with western-style floats and vehicles from local sponsors.  ABC 7 Amarillo
  • Panhandle-Plains Historical Museum invites locals to its Christmas Open House today on its East Lawn from 1 p.m. to 3 p.m. The event features crafts + cookies + cocoa + choirs and Santa photos offered for $10 to $20 while guests may donate $1 or bring a can for the High Plains Food Bank.  NewsChannel 10

ECONOMY NEWS

  • Amarillo National Bank released its November Economic Analysis, reporting retail sales rose 12%, new car sales increased 32%, and used car sales climbed 48% from a year ago despite lower housing and agricultural commodities & falling oil prices. The analysis noted steady construction, rising housing starts, and data center activity.  KGNC

EDUCATION NEWS

  • Fifteen high school students were selected for FirstBank Southwest’s Banking Advisory Council (BAC) as part of a competitive program offering hands-on community banking learning and mentorship. The program runs monthly from October through May and brings together local students to build real-world skills.  Amarillo Globe-News

ENVIRONMENT NEWS

  • Texas A&M Forest Service is offering up to $80,000 in grants through the Texas Resilient Landscapes Initiative to help landowners restore native trees on properties of 10-150 acres that lost trees in the past 10 years. Officials will visit properties in areas with limited recovery funding & provide guidance, and applications are due by January 23.  ABC 7 Amarillo
